Latest Patents

One of Knecht's latest patents is a control device and method for determining the rotor angle of a synchronous machine. This invention involves generating a multiplicity of pulse-width-modulated drive signals for the phases of an inverter that feeds the synchronous machine. The method includes applying phase shifts to these signals to extend the duration of the inverter's switching states, thereby creating specific switching patterns. This innovative approach allows for accurate determination of the rotor angle based on neutral point potentials.
